Pertanyaan yang diberi tag replace

123
Panda Pengganti Bersyarat

Saya memiliki DataFrame, dan saya ingin mengganti nilai di kolom tertentu yang melebihi nilai dengan nol. Saya pikir ini adalah cara untuk mencapai ini: df[df.my_channel > 20000].my_channel = 0 Jika saya menyalin saluran ke dalam bingkai data baru, itu sederhana: df2 = df.my_channel df2[df2...

121
Ruby mengganti string dengan pola regex yang ditangkap

Saya mengalami masalah saat menerjemahkan ini ke dalam Ruby. Berikut adalah bagian dari JavaScript yang melakukan persis apa yang ingin saya lakukan: function get_code(str){ return str.replace(/^(Z_.*): .*/,"$1")​​​​​​​​​​​​​​​​​​​​​​​​​​​; } Saya telah mencoba gsub , sub , dan mengganti...

119
Eclipse, pencarian dan penggantian ekspresi reguler

Dalam gerhana, apakah mungkin menggunakan string pencarian yang cocok sebagai bagian dari string pengganti saat melakukan pencarian ekspresi reguler dan penggantian? Pada dasarnya, saya ingin mengganti semua kemunculan variableName.someMethod() dengan: ((TypeName)variableName.someMethod()) Di...

117
Cari dan ganti di Vim di semua file proyek

Saya mencari cara terbaik untuk melakukan pencarian dan penggantian (dengan konfirmasi) di semua file proyek di Vim. Yang saya maksud dengan "file proyek" adalah file di direktori saat ini, beberapa di antaranya tidak harus dibuka. Salah satu cara untuk melakukannya adalah dengan membuka semua...

115
Str_replace untuk beberapa item

Saya ingat melakukan ini sebelumnya, tetapi tidak dapat menemukan kodenya. Saya menggunakan str_replace untuk mengganti satu karakter seperti ini: str_replace(':', ' ', $string);tetapi saya ingin mengganti semua karakter berikut \/:*?"<>|, tanpa melakukan str_replace untuk

113
Ganti JavaScript / regex

Diberikan fungsi ini: function Repeater(template) { var repeater = { markup: template, replace: function(pattern, value) { this.markup = this.markup.replace(pattern, value); } }; return repeater; }; Bagaimana cara saya melakukan this.markup.replace()penggantian secara global? Inilah...

110
VIM Ganti kata dengan isi buffer tempel?

Saya perlu melakukan banyak penggantian kata dalam file dan ingin melakukannya dengan perintah vi, bukan perintah EX seperti :%s///g. Saya tahu bahwa ini adalah cara umum untuk mengganti kata pada posisi kursor saat ini: cw<text><esc>tetapi adakah cara untuk melakukan ini dengan isi...